U.K. student ‘linked to jet shootdown’ under house arrest
     2014-July-22  08:53    Shenzhen Daily

    A BRITISH student is a major player in Ukraine’s rebel group that is accused of shooting down the Malaysian jet MH17, killing 298 innocents, the Daily Mirror reported Sunday.

    Beness Aijo, 29, has been under house arrest in Latvia, where security sources say he is “a dangerous and influential individual,” the report said.

    Aijo is a “major player” in the group and has close ties with its commander Igor Girkin, who is widely blamed for the atrocity that killed 298 passengers and crew, it said.

    Aijo — who has numerous convictions for violent political extremism — studied microbiology at London’s prestigious Birkbeck College and worked on the reconstruction of Heathrow Terminal 2.

    He left the United Kingdom in March after six years in the country to join the pro-Putin paramilitary forces that raided Crimea, the report said.

    In May, he was arrested and deported back to Britain, but he slipped out of the country again, heading for Ukraine to join separatist fighters.(SD-Agencies)
